Ripple Co-Founder Chris Larsen’s $1 Million Donation to Kamala Harris PAC Raises Concerns in Crypto Community

In a move that has sparked significant debate within the cryptocurrency community, Chris Larsen, co-founder of Ripple, has donated $1 million worth of XRP to a Political Action Committee (PAC) supporting U.S. Vice President Kamala Harris’s presidential campaign. The donation, made to the Future Forward USA PAC, marks the first documented cryptocurrency contribution to Harris’s campaign

The Donation

According to Federal Election Commission (FEC) filings, Larsen’s donation was made on August 14, 2024, and consisted of 1.75 million XRP tokens. The funds were converted into the USDC stablecoin through Coinbase Commerce to minimize the potential impact of cryptocurrency volatility. This contribution is part of Larsen’s broader efforts to support pro-crypto candidates and initiatives.

Community Reactions

The donation has raised eyebrows within the crypto community for several reasons:

  1. Regulatory Scrutiny: Ripple has been embroiled in a legal battle with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) over the classification of XRP as a security. Some community members view Larsen’s donation as a strategic move to gain political favor and potentially influence regulatory outcomes.
  2. Transparency and Ethics: The use of cryptocurrency in political donations is still a relatively new and unregulated area. Critics argue that such contributions could lead to questions about transparency and the ethical implications of using digital assets to fund political campaigns.
  3. Market Impact: The donation has also led to concerns about the potential market impact of large-scale cryptocurrency transactions. While the conversion to USDC helps mitigate volatility, the sheer size of the donation has nonetheless drawn attention.

Implications for the Crypto Industry

Larsen’s donation underscores the growing intersection between cryptocurrency and politics. As digital assets become more mainstream, their role in political funding is likely to increase. This development raises important questions about the need for clear regulations and guidelines to ensure transparency and fairness in the political process.

While the move has garnered support from some quarters, it has also raised significant concerns within the crypto community. As the industry continues to grow, the need for robust regulatory frameworks and ethical guidelines will become increasingly important.
